- [ ] **Step 7: Breaker override escrow.** After sealing the signing keys for the Tallgrove upstream API circuit breaker, confirm the support team can force the breaker open during a full outage. The override bundle lives in the sealed escrow drawer and is useless without its unlock phrase. Two ceremony witnesses must initial this step before proceeding. The escrow bundle is decrypted with the recovery passphrase that follows.

vault phrase of kahip-kahop = holath-quenmir

**TICKET-4471: Vault locked after rounding mismatch**

Hey folks — welcome aboard. Quick context: the Pennywise conversion job rounds half-up, but the ledger vault in Coinloft rounds banker's-style, so end-of-day totals drifted by a cent and the vault auto-locked itself (it does that on any mismatch, annoying but intentional).

Fix is merged; we just need to unlock the vault to replay yesterday's batch. Use the recovery passphrase below when the unlock wizard asks.

vault phrase of fahog-yajof = istael-zorwyn

Subject: Insurance Renewal — Action Required

Dear branch managers, our property and liability policy with Fenwright Mutual renews at month-end. Premiums rise modestly, but coverage now includes flood protection for the Darrowfield sites. Please verify your branch asset registers are current before the renewal date, as valuations feed directly into our premium. One confidential note accompanies this message:

board note of kageg-bahof: The renewal with Holwynax Holdings closes at $2 million a year, 5 percent below the last contract. Project Ulaath slips by two quarters because of the supplier delay.

### Step 4: Configure the validator

After installing Feedcheckr, point it at your podcast catalog and enable strict RSS validation. The legacy Podlint rules are no longer supported, so remove any old rule files before starting the service. Once the binary is in place, create the config file with the following values.

settings of yageg-yahap:
[gorael]
team = olieth
access_code = ac_941d74
owner = brieth.aldiel
host = gorael.tolvaqio.internal
port = 6379
peer = briwyn.urlaqtech.internal
salt = 116e6622
pin = 1957